Access & Borrowing Policies

Your TC3 Card serves as your library card. Both full and part-time students can obtain this photo ID in Room 110. No library materials will be checked out to a student without a valid TC3 Card. It is also required to access our subscription databases.

We welcome community residents to use our services. You can obtain a Community Borrower card by completing an application and providing proof of identification to library staff. If you are completing it off-campus, we will contact you to verify your identification. Once approved, your new card will be mailed to you and you will be able to check out items. You can add money to your card for printing and photocopying in the Baker Commons or to use in the cafeteria or campus vending machines.

Books - Books circulate for three weeks. Students may check out up to ten items. Two renewals can be made unless another patron has requested the book. Renewals can be made at the circulation desk, online (see View Your Library Account) or over the phone (844-8222, ext. 4360).

Overdue Notices - Students and staff will receive notification of overdue library books and media via their TC3 student e-mail accounts (@mymail.tc3.edu). Information about setting up the account can be found on the TC3 Student E-mail page.

Stoplist - If you are on the Library Stoplist, have lost a book, or wish to pay a fine, please contact Lucy Yang at ext. 4361.

Periodicals - Magazines, journals, and newspapers must be used in the library.

Reserves - Reserves are available at the Circulation Desk. Most reserve items may be used for 2 hours in the library. You must have a TC3 Card to use reserve items. Fines for late Reserve materials are 25 cents an hour, per item.
